About the role

Key responsibilities & impact
  • Lead the growth strategy and own outcomes for a focused portfolio of 2–3 enterprise accounts
  • Define account growth goals covering philanthropic gift volume, product module adoption, financial advisor penetration, and other metrics
  • Build, test, refine, and execute account-specific growth plans within responsible risk parameters
  • Develop quantitative firm-specific growth models using data, NPS, focus groups, experimentation, and customer feedback loops
  • Evaluate and sequence growth initiatives based on opportunity size, strategic fit, resources, and risk/return trade-offs
  • Cultivate executive-level relationships across client leadership, business units, regional leadership, operations, technology, and philanthropy teams
  • Track and manage stakeholders, including influencers, champions, and decision-makers
  • Advise client leadership on competitive landscape, organizational goals, and philanthropic strategy
  • Build business cases with client stakeholders for incremental investment in giving-related integrations
  • Map end-to-end user journeys to identify financial-advisor workflow integration opportunities
  • Partner with product and operations teams to develop client-shaped workflow solutions and drive adoption
  • Engage client operations, technology, and business leaders in designing and implementing integrations
  • Translate client feedback into product roadmap input and close the delivery loop
  • Coordinate cross-functionally across marketing, field/relationship teams, analytics, product, and operations
  • Build account-level reporting and dashboards covering account health, growth trajectory, risks, and mitigation
  • Coordinate with product marketing, charitable strategists, and operations leads to ensure go-to-client readiness

Requirements

What you’ll need
  • Bachelor's degree in business management, sales, or another related field
  • 8–12 years of experience in enterprise growth, strategic account management, or management consulting
  • Meaningful exposure to financial institutions, fintech, or financial services
  • Experience in regulated environments preferred
  • In-depth understanding of how operations and product capabilities translate into growth
  • Demonstrated ownership of growth outcomes in complex, high-value accounts
  • Ability to connect client needs to internal capabilities and drive execution
  • Strong analytical mindset, including modeling growth opportunities, assessing resource trade-offs, and building rigorous business cases
  • Exceptional executive presence and comfort with C-suite engagement and high-stakes presentations
  • Proven ability to lead cross-functional teams through influence and informal authority
  • Ability to create structure in ambiguous situations, move from strategy to execution, and navigate fintech compliance and operational constraints

  • Fintech Ren is America’s premier provider of philanthropic technology and managed services, supporting over $150 billion in charitable assets and distributing over $50 billion to charities. The company offers various giving vehicles, including donor-advised funds, charitable trusts, and annuities, allowing clients to effectively achieve their charitable goals. Ren also provides resources and insights for advisors and donors to navigate charitable giving strategies.
